The Unique Science of Denver Basements and High Altitude
Denver sits at 5,280 feet above sea level, which affects how air and moisture behave inside your home. Lower atmospheric pressure means that air exerts less weight on surfaces, and the boiling point of water is lower. More importantly, the temperature differential between a cool basement and the warm Colorado sun can lead to condensation on foundation walls.
Temperature Differentials and Condensation
Even in a drought, Denver basements can experience condensation. During a hot July day in Capitol Hill or Cherry Creek, the outdoor air can reach 95 degrees. If that air enters a basement cooled to 65 degrees by the surrounding earth, the moisture in the air reaches its dew point and clings to the concrete walls or floor joists. This localized moisture is enough to trigger the growth of microbes that produce microbial volatile organic compounds (mVOCs). These gases are what we perceive as that "musty" smell.
Soil Expansion and Foundation Health
Colorado is known for expansive bentonite clay soils. When it rains or when snow melts rapidly in the spring, the soil expands and puts immense pressure on foundation walls. This can create hairline fractures that allow moisture vapor to seep into finished basements. According to the CDPHE Mold guidelines, managing moisture is the most critical step in preventing indoor air quality issues. If your Denver home has a crawl space or a partially finished basement, the interaction between the soil and your living space is a primary driver of odor issues.
Identifying the Source of the Musty Odor
Before you can effectively treat a smell, you must identify where it is coming from. A musty smell is rarely just "air." It is usually the result of active mold, mildew, or bacteria feeding on organic material such as wood, drywall paper, or carpet fibers.
Active Mold Growth
Mold is the most common culprit for basement odors. According to the EPA Mold Basics documentation, mold can grow on virtually any organic substance as long as moisture and oxygen are present. In Denver, this often happens behind the drywall of finished basements where homeowners cannot see it. If you have had a past sump pump failure or a slow leak from a window well during a summer rainstorm, mold may be thriving in the wall cavity.
Biofilms and Bacteria
It is not just mold that causes smells. Bacteria can form biofilms on cool, damp surfaces like concrete floors or water heater closets. Bacteria also release gases during their life cycle. These smells are often sharper or more "sour" than the heavy, earthy smell of mold. Professional remediation focuses on neutralizing both the fungal and bacterial components of the odor.
Forgotten Spills and Pet Accidents
In the drier climate of the Front Range, liquids evaporate quickly, but the solids they leave behind do not go away. Old pet accidents in a basement carpet can lie dormant for months until the humidity rises above 50 percent. At that point, the urea crystals in the carpet re-hydrate and begin to off-gas. This creates a cycle where the basement smells fine in the winter but becomes unbearable during the humid days of August.
Why Traditional Cleaning Methods Often Fail
Many Denver homeowners try to tackle musty smells with store bought solutions, but these often fall short for various reasons.
The Problem with Fragrance Masking
Plugins, sprays, and scented oils do not remove odor molecules. They simply overwhelm your olfactory senses with a stronger scent. This is problematic because the underlying cause of the odor (mold or bacteria) continues to grow. Masking an odor is like painting over rust. Eventually, the problem will break through the surface, and the combination of floral scents and musty mold is often worse than the original smell.
The Limitations of Ozone
For years, ozone machines were the standard for odor removal. However, ozone has significant drawbacks. It is a powerful lung irritant and can react with synthetic materials in your home (like carpet padding or rubber) to create new, toxic chemicals. Furthermore, ozone is an unstable molecule that often fails to penetrate deeply into porous materials like wooden floor joists or concrete pores. In the high altitude of Denver, the thin air can even affect the efficiency of ozone generation.
Why Bleach Is Not the Answer
Many people reach for bleach to kill mold on porous surfaces. However, as noted by the CDC Basic Facts About Mold, bleach is mostly water. On a porous surface like wood or drywall, the chlorine stays on the surface while the water soaks in, potentially feeding the very mold you are trying to kill.

Humidity Control in the Mile High City
Controlling the environment is essential for long-term odor prevention. Even after a professional Stink Stompers treatment, you must manage your indoor climate to prevent the return of odors.
The Role of Dehumidification
While Denver is generally dry, the American Society of Heating, Refrigerating and Air-Conditioning Engineers suggests specific standards for indoor air. You can find more detail on these standards via ASHRAE Humidity Control resources. For a basement, keeping the relative humidity below 50 percent is vital. In the summer, a dedicated basement dehumidifier can pull gallons of water out of the air that would otherwise settle on your walls.
Proper Airflow and Ventilation
Many Denver basements are poorly ventilated. Houses in neighborhoods like Park Hill or Congress Park often have small, original windows that are rarely opened. Improving airflow helps equalize the temperature and prevents stagnant pockets of air where odors can concentrate. Using a high-quality HVAC filter and ensuring your cold air returns are not blocked can make a massive difference in how your basement smells.
Handling the Aftermath of Water Intrusion
If your musty smell started after a heavy rain or a burst pipe, the approach must be more aggressive. Water damage in Colorado can lead to rapid fungal growth because the high altitude does not prevent mold; it just changes the timeline.
Immediate Extraction and Drying
According to FEMA Flood Cleanup protocols, the first 24 to 48 hours are the most critical. If moisture stays in drywall or carpet padding longer than that, mold growth is virtually guaranteed. If you have a flooded basement, you must strip out the wet materials before odor remediation can begin. Checking Window Wells
In Denver, window wells are a frequent source of basement moisture. If your window wells are clogged with leaves or debris, they can hold water against your foundation during a spring thunderstorm. This water eventually find its way into your basement. Keeping these areas clean and covered is a simple preventative measure that saves thousands in remediation costs.
Health Implications of a Musty Basement
A musty smell is more than an annoyance; it is an indicator of poor air quality. For residents of Colorado, where respiratory health is often a priority for those who enjoy the outdoors, basement air quality should not be ignored.
Respiratory Sensitivity
Vapors from mold and bacteria can irritate the lungs and sinuses. For individuals with asthma or allergies, spending time in a musty basement can trigger symptoms like coughing, wheezing, or itchy eyes. By removing the biological source of the odor, you are also removing the various irritants that can lower your quality of life.
